Carmen Marc Valvo presented his 25th Anniversary Collection of 51 looks on Sept. 5, 2014. The designer is known for his gorgeous eveningwear and cocktail dresses, but he certainly surprised us with his inclusion of menswear in this collection.
Valvo presented a popular spring trend, which is the midi hemline on his dresses. He repeated several of his feminine floral prints and subtle metallic sheen in vary silhouettes, including the midi dresses, long evening gowns, statement pants, sportswear, and suit jackets. There were many eye-catching moments during this show: a sheer cobalt blue gown with edgy shoulder cutouts, a soft gold gown with prints that resembled falling leaves, and the excellent crafted jackets and blazers for men.
Once again, Valvo amazed us with his talent to create luxurious evening wear for women. All the dresses had great fit and movement, as well as glamorous prints and details. But he also debuted his talent for menswear. We saw red carpet moments and casual chic for the men on the runway that fit right with the graceful, confident women on the runway.
